The Ultimate Buying Guide: Sticky Traps for Pesky Pests

Got unwanted guests like mice, roaches, or spiders making your home uncomfortable? Glue traps, also known as sticky traps, offer a simple way to catch them. This guide will help you pick the best ones for your needs.

1. Key Features to Look For

When you shop for glue traps, keep these important features in mind:

  • Adhesive Strength: This is the most crucial feature. You need a trap with strong glue that can hold onto pests effectively. A weak adhesive won’t do the job.
  • Size and Shape: Traps come in different sizes and shapes. Some are flat, while others fold into a box. Consider where you’ll place them and what kind of pests you’re trying to catch. Larger traps are better for bigger pests or areas where you might catch multiple bugs.
  • Durability: Good glue traps are made from sturdy materials. They shouldn’t tear or fall apart easily, especially if you’re using them in damp or dusty areas.
  • Scent/Bait (Optional): Some traps have a mild scent or bait to attract pests. This can make them more effective, especially for rodents.
  • Safety Features: For homes with pets or small children, look for traps designed with safety in mind. Some have covers or are designed to be less accessible to curious paws or fingers.

2. Important Materials

The materials used in glue traps affect their performance and longevity. Most traps use:

  • Cardboard or Plastic Base: This forms the main structure of the trap. Cardboard is common and often more affordable. Plastic bases are usually more durable and easier to clean if they get dirty.
  • Non-Toxic Adhesive: The sticky substance is the heart of the trap. Reputable manufacturers use non-toxic glues that are safe for the environment and won’t harm pets if they accidentally touch them (though it’s best to avoid contact). The glue should remain sticky for a long time.

3.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

Several things can make a glue trap better or worse:

  • Improved Quality:
    • Consistent Adhesive Coverage: A trap with even sticky glue all over its surface works best.
    • Thick, Sturdy Base: A strong base prevents the trap from bending or breaking when a pest is caught.
    • Resealable Packaging: If you don’t need to use all the traps at once, resealable packaging keeps the unused ones fresh and sticky.
  • Reduced Quality:
    • Uneven or Weak Glue: Patches of no glue or glue that loses its stickiness quickly are a major problem.
    • Flimsy Construction: Traps that are too thin or made of cheap material can easily be damaged.
    • Bad Odor: Some glues can have a chemical smell that might deter pests or be unpleasant for humans.

4. User Experience and Use Cases

Glue traps are generally easy to use. You simply place them in areas where you’ve seen pests. They are great for:

  • Catching Crawling Insects: Roaches, ants, spiders, and silverfish are common targets. Place traps along walls, in corners, or under sinks.
  • Monitoring for Rodents: Mice and rats can be caught. Place traps in areas where droppings are found, like kitchens, basements, or attics.
  • Preventing Infestations: Using traps can help you spot a problem early before it gets out of hand.
  • Non-Chemical Pest Control: They offer an alternative to sprays and poisons, which can be helpful for people concerned about chemicals.

Remember, glue traps are for catching pests. Once a pest is caught, the trap needs to be disposed of carefully. Always follow the manufacturer’s instructions for placement and disposal.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: Are glue traps humane?

A: This is a debated topic. Glue traps are effective at catching pests, but the method of capture can cause distress to the animal. Some people find them to be an acceptable solution, while others prefer more humane methods.

Q: How long do glue traps last?

A: The effectiveness of a glue trap depends on its quality and the environment. Good quality traps can remain sticky for several weeks or even months if kept in a dry, dust-free place. However, dust, moisture, or extreme temperatures can reduce their lifespan.

Q: Can glue traps catch anything other than pests?

A: Yes, glue traps can potentially catch small pets like birds or lizards if they accidentally step on them. It’s important to place them in areas where pets cannot reach them.

Q: Do I need to bait glue traps?

A: Most glue traps are designed to attract pests with their sticky surface alone. However, some people add a small amount of bait, like peanut butter for mice, to make them even more appealing.

Q: What is the best place to put glue traps?

A: Place glue traps along walls, in corners, under furniture, in cabinets, or anywhere you have seen pest activity. For rodents, place them perpendicular to walls where they travel.

Q: How do I dispose of a glue trap with a pest?

A: Carefully fold the trap in half, enclosing the pest. You can then place it in a plastic bag and dispose of it in your regular trash. Always wear gloves.

Q: Are glue traps safe for children and pets?

A: While the glue itself is usually non-toxic, it’s best to keep traps out of reach of children and pets to prevent accidental contact or injury.

Q: Can glue traps catch bed bugs?

A: Glue traps are not typically effective for catching bed bugs. Bed bugs are better caught with specialized traps designed for them.

Q: How often should I check my glue traps?

A: It’s a good idea to check your glue traps every few days to remove any caught pests and to see if you have an ongoing problem.

Q: Can I reuse a glue trap?

A: No, once a glue trap has caught a pest or its adhesive has become compromised, it should be disposed of and replaced with a new one.
